Question to the Home Office:

To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, how many firearms have been imported into the UK by registered importers from other countries within the EU in each of the last five years.

This question was answered on 30th March 2017

The total numbers of transfer of firearms into the UK by registered importers from the EU for the last five years is as follows:

Total number of transfers

  • April 2012 – March 2013 2,458

  • April 2013 – March 2014 4,969

  • April 2014 – March 2015 3,528

  • April 2015 – March 2016 4,231

  • April 2016 – March 2017 3,692 (up to 21st March 2017)

These figures represent the number of commercial movements. The total numbers of firearms from these transfers have not routinely been collated albeit the information is held on each record.
